O2 (Europe) Ltd., commonly known as O2, is a leading telecommunications provider headquartered in Great Britain. Established in 1985, the company has grown to become a prominent player in the mobile and broadband industry, serving millions of customers across the UK and Europe. O2 is renowned for its innovative mobile services, including 4G and 5G connectivity, as well as its comprehensive range of devices and accessories. The company distinguishes itself through its commitment to customer service and sustainability initiatives, making it a preferred choice for consumers and businesses alike. With a strong market position, O2 has achieved numerous accolades, including recognition for its network reliability and customer satisfaction. As a subsidiary of Telefónica, O2 continues to shape the future of telecommunications with cutting-edge technology and a focus on enhancing user experience.
